Overview

This grant funds placements at international cultural institutions for researchers. You can get between £6,000 and £16,200 to cover your placement costs. You must be either a PhD student funded by AHRC or ESRC, or an early career researcher at a UK research organisation. The money helps pay for your international placement experience. Applications close on 19 March 2026. You need to be based at a UK research organisation that can receive UKRI funding.

Who is this for?

This grant is for PhD students who receive funding from AHRC or ESRC, and early career researchers at UK universities or research institutions. You must be based at an organisation that can receive UKRI funding. It is not for established academics or researchers outside the UK.
